Kit Review

Straight build

This kit is the Xeno Alma Blaze Ophis, released as part of Kotobukiya's Arcanadia series. It's a companion kit to the simultaneously released Xeno Alma Flame Stral,and just like the previously released Hydro Zephos & and Trickle Decapodia,it can combine with other kits. It can be used independently or combined with Flame Stral as Arcanadia Lumitea'sarmament.

The overall build quality is on par with Flame Stral, with a striking color combination and solid enough part retention. That said, there aren't as many articulated sections as you might expect, so posing options are somewhat limited with just the main body on its own. And because of its elongated dragon-with-wings shape, a stand with two clamp-style grips is included. On top of that, a number of joint parts for various combination configurations are also bundled in.

Disassembling the main body and attaching it to Lumitea is a fairly straightforward process, and it's a fun touch that the body splits apart to form two legs. The remaining parts can be assembled into a large bow-like shape for use as a weapon. You can also combine it with Flame Stral to recreate the four-legged Explode Volcarion. And just like the previous kits, you can attach both to Lumitea together to recreate the large-winged configuration.

All in all, the Xeno Alma Blaze Ophis stays true to the Xeno Alma series concept of offering all sorts of combination and crossover play. It's definitely a kit that's more fun when built alongside Flame Stral and Lumitea rather than on its own. :-)
